Meaning of Lahar

Lahar derives directly from the Sanskrit word ‘lahara’ (लहर), which specifically means ‘wave’, ‘flood’, ‘torrent’, or ‘stream’. In Sanskrit literature and grammar, this term appears in contexts describing water movement, ocean waves, or flowing currents. The word has been preserved in modern Indian languages like Hindi, Bengali, and Marathi with the same core meaning. Linguistically, it belongs to the rich vocabulary of natural phenomena in Sanskrit, sharing roots with other water-related terms in Indo-Aryan languages. The name’s meaning is well-documented in Sanskrit dictionaries and etymological sources, making it one of the clearer name meanings with ancient linguistic evidence.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Lahar originates from Sanskrit, the classical language of ancient India that has influenced numerous modern South Asian languages. As a Sanskrit-derived name, it is primarily used within Hindu communities, though its linguistic roots predate specific religious boundaries. The name appears in historical texts and has been used traditionally in various regions of India, particularly in areas with strong Sanskrit literary traditions. While not among the most common Sanskrit names, it represents the enduring influence of Sanskrit vocabulary on personal naming practices. The name’s connection to natural elements reflects the importance of nature symbolism in Indian cultural traditions.
